After announcing the GWR Manor back in February 2021, Accurascale have finally delivered their first 00 gauge steam locomotive and I couldn’t wait to get my hands on it!
Today I’m taking a look at Dinmore Manor, just one of many brand new Manors that Accurascale have recently released and I’m incredibly grateful to them for providing this model for today’s review video. It’s also a sound fitted model too so I can really put this loco through it’s paces and check out everything it has to offer.
With a mostly metal body, tons of detail and additional features such as firebox flicker and built in stay alive capacitors, on paper this new Manor from Accurascale looks like an incredible model. Will it live up to the incredibly high standards that Accurascale have set itself with the Deltic and Class 37? Or are steam locos just harder to get right?

Is there anyone with a sound fitted model that can tell me what functions F5, F6, F10, F12 and whatever there comes after F18 are? I unfortunately don't have a sheet with all the sound functions because I've bought an analog one first (the dcc sf one was already sold out), and putted a accurascale sounddecoder in later on. I can't find the sheet anywhere and luckily this great video helped a lot to find most of the things.
@ThatModelRailwayGuy
@ThatModelRailwayGuy 2 месяца назад
I have them listed as follows: F5 - Heavy Mode F6 - Light Engine Mode F10 - Cylinder Cocks F12 - Uncouple Shuffle F19 - Flange Squeal F20 - Fade Out Sound Basically these are all sounds that only play while the loco is in motion in someway - hence why they weren't featured in the run down of functions. Those names are just what I have them listed as so they may not be the official terms. But you can always get in touch with Accurascale for an official list, their customer service is pretty good and I imagine it wouldn't be to hard to send over.
